An official Health Canada notice concerns Nitrous oxide chargers: sold for inhalation without market authorization (din). The affected product(s) are sold for inhalation without market authorization (DIN) in Canada. Published 2026-03-12.
What to do now
Do not inhale nitrous oxide products for recreational purposes. Seek immediate medical attention from a health care professional (physician, nurse, pharmacist, Canadian Poison Centre) if you have used nitrous oxide recreationally or for medical purposes and have experienced any side effects. For Poison Centre access you can contact 1-844 POISON-X, in Quebec 1-800-463-5060, or contact your local poison centre directly. Health Canada has also published information about stopping substance use. Report any health product-related side effects or complaints to Health Canada.
